@@ -138,6 +138,15 @@ if(NOT "${FOUND_INDEX}" STREQUAL "-1")
list(REMOVE_ITEM LLVM_ENABLE_PROJECTS "pstl")
endif()
+if ("openmp" IN_LIST LLVM_ENABLE_PROJECTS)
+ message(FATAL_ERROR "
+Support for the LLVM_ENABLE_PROJECTS=openmp build mode has been removed. Switch to the bootstrapping build
+ cmake -S <llvm-project>/llvm -B build -DLLVM_ENABLE_PROJECTS=clang -DLLVM_ENABLE_RUNTIMES=openmp
+or to the runtimes default build
+ cmake -S <llvm-project>/runtimes -B build -DLLVM_ENABLE_RUNTIMES=openmp
+")
+endif()
